The size of Kinross is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 11 parks, covering nearly 10.3% of the total area. The population of Kinross in 2016 was 6890 people. By 2021 the population was 6988 showing a population growth of 1.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kinross is 50-59 years. Households in Kinross are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kinross work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 81.80% of the homes in Kinross were owner-occupied compared with 78.80% in 2016.
